O.M.P.(MISC.)(COMM.) 1010/2024 3.

This is a petition under Sections 29A (4) and (5) of the Arbitration and Conciliation Act, 1996 ('Act of 1996') seeking extension of mandate of the Arbitral Tribunal in the Arbitration proceedings titled as "Thor Ventures (OPC) Private Limited v. NyeQ Technologies Private Limited" bearing numbers DIAC/6114/03-2023 and DIAC/6034/03-2023, by a period of 6 months w.e.f. 25.09.2024 for completion of arbitral proceedings and making of arbitral award.

4.

Mr. Rajiv Bajaj, Advocate enters appearance on behalf of the Respondent and states that he as well, joins the Petitioner's request of extending the mandate of the Arbitral Tribunal considering that the proceedings are at an advance stage.

6.

Having considered the averments made in the petition and in view of joint request of the parties, the petition is allowed and the mandate of the Arbitral Tribunal for completion of arbitral proceedings and for passing an arbitral award is extended w.e.f. 26.09.2024 until 30.06.2025. 7.

The parties are directed not to seek any unnecessary adjournments before the Arbitral Tribunal so as to enable the passing of the award within the time extended.

8.

Accordingly, the petition stands allowed in the above terms.
